PASADENA, CA — This week, the Federal Bureau of Investigations (FBI) conducted a raid on the federal correctional institution (FCI) in Dublin, California. FCI Dublin Warden Art Dulgov was replaced by regional Bureau of Prisons (BOP) Supervisor Nancy T. McKinney, and three other top managers were removed from their positions by the BOP.

WASHINGTON, D.C. — Today, Representatives Judy Chu (CA-28) and Mariannette Miller-Meeks (IA-01) introduced legislation to ensure that breast cancer patients and survivors who have had a mastectomy are able to access custom breast prosthetics under Medicare. The Breast Cancer Patient Equity Act would provide coverage for custom fabricated breast prostheses to the more than 100,000 women who undergo mastectomies annually.
